Description-en: Linux kernel image for version 4.4.0 on 64 bit x86 SMP
This package contains the Linux kernel image for version 4.4.0 on
64 bit x86 SMP.
.
Also includes the corresponding System.map file, the modules built by the
packager, and scripts that try to ensure that the system is not left in an
unbootable state after an update.
.
Supports AWS processors.
.
Geared toward Amazon Web Services (AWS) systems.
.
You likely do not want to install this package directly. Instead, install
the linux-aws meta-package, which will ensure that upgrades work
correctly, and that supporting packages are also installed.
